ibn abi sadiq neishaboori was the iranian philosopher and medical scientist in the fifth century ah. in addition to writing a number of books in traditional medicine, he wrote commentary explanations on important books of famous greek and roman physicians, hippocrates and galen. because of this, he was called hippocrates the second.ibn abi sadiqwas the student of avicennaand the teacher of jor...

BACKGROUND Abū Bakr Muhammad ibn Zakariyyā al-Rāzī, known as Rhazes in the Western world (854-925 CE), was an Iranian polymath, physician and one of the most prominent sages in the medieval period. He wrote several medical books and treaties such as "Continents", a comprehensive medical encyclopedia, treaties in smallpox and measles, "Al-Mansuri" and many other important manuscripts in the medi...
